G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The IRT-6630-DTR is a transmit/receive (transceiver) module designed principally for use as a serial data fibre optic
transmission link for 3G-SDI, HD-SDI or SD-SDI applications conforming to SMPTE standards 424M, 292M and
259M-C using 9/125 μm single mode fibre. This enables the use of space saving fibre optic cable for reliable
transmission of digital video signals over lengths greater than can be achieved with coaxial cable.
In addition, the link may be used for ASI transport streams for use with MPEG compressed video streams or other
270 Mb/s type data.
The transmitter section features automatic input cable equalisation. A “keep link alive” signal is available to
maintain optical link operation when no electrical input is present.
Two inputs are provided with automatic changeover to input 2 on loss of input 1 for input signal redundancy.
The receiver section uses an APD detector with signal conditioning and reclocking
circuits. The data rate is
automatically set to match the 3G-SDI, HD-SDI or SD-SDI/ASI rates dependent on the actual input data rate to the
transmitter.
The IRT-6630-DTR can be used as an independent transmitter and receiver at the same time allowing bi-directional
operation over two single mode fibres. Being independent from each other, the transmit and receive signals can be
of mixed signal types.
Optionally a 1310/1550nm WDM
2, 3
optical combiner can be fitted to allow for combined use on a single fibre.
The IRT-6630-DTR is designed to fit the openGear® standard 2RU frames which allow a mixture of cards from
various manufacturers to be mounted within the same frame.

Standard features:
•
Transports 3G-SDI, HD-SDI, SD-SDI or ASI signal rates.
•
Single or bi-directional operation possible with independent transmit and receive functions on the
one card.
•
Path lengths up to 30 dB
1
optical path loss using 9/125μm single mode fibre.
•
Automatic changeover switching of input for signal redundancy on Tx.
•
Optional on-board WDM
2, 3
optical combiner for use on a single common fibre.
•
DashBoard™ software monitoring and control.
NOTE: 1
27dB path loss at 3G. Typically >30dB at HD and SD. Fitted with APD detector.
2
With WDM option fitted for combined use on a single fibre, optical path loss is reduced by
approximately 2dB.
3
With WDM option fitted, when operating as a pair, one IRT-6630-DTR must be fitted with a
1310nm laser and the other a 1550nm laser.
